1/111. Arterial switch with internal pulmonary artery banding. A new palliation for TGA and VSD in complex cases.

    In most cases, one stage repair by arterial switch operation (ASO) is the optimal treatment for neonates with transposition of the great arteries (TGA). Nevertheless, a ventricular septal defect (VSD) associated with TGA remains a major risk factor for early death and reoperation after complete repair in neonates with complex anatomy. A new palliative approach for such specific cases is proposed. An internal pulmonary artery banding (IPAB), as that already used to palliate other cardiac malformations, is performed in association with ASO instead of VSD closure. At the end of ASO, a circular polytetrafluorethylene (PTFE) patch with a 4-mm central hole is oversewn into the neo-pulmonary trunk. We adopted this method in a 17-day-old boy with TGA, VSD, hypoplastic tricuspid valve and diminutive right ventricle. After the operation the child thrived and was doing well without medication. Satisfactory growth of the right ventricle and tricuspid valve was observed by echocardiography during the following months. The patient successfully underwent VSD closure and IPAB removal 2 years after the first procedure. ASO with IPAB could be appropriate in all forms of TGA and VSD in which VSD closure appears too challenging in the neonatal period and in patients with uncertain suitability for biventricular repair. We preferred to use IPAB instead of classic PAB in order to reduce the risk of pulmonary valve damage, pulmonary artery distortion, and above all pulmonary artery dilatation and related coronary compression. In the presented case the strategy as well as IPAB worked according to our expectations.

2/111. Arterial switch operation: successful bilateral internal thoracic artery grafting.

    Internal thoracic artery grafting in arterial switch operations for transposition of great arteries has been reported for salvage of myocardial ischemia after initial coronary transfer. We report a situation where we opted for primary coronary bypass grafting to avoid an obviously difficult coronary transfer, with successful outcome.

3/111. Congenitally corrected transposition with pulmonary atresia and intact ventricular septum.

    We describe a patient with the rare association of the heart in the left chest, congenitally corrected transposition, pulmonary atresia and an intact ventricular septum. There were associated fistulous communications between the morphologically left ventricle and the coronary arteries. diagnosis was made by echocardiography, and subsequently confirmed by cardiac catheterization.

4/111. Kartagener's syndrome with corrected transposition. Conducting system studies and coronary arterial occlusion complicating valvular replacement.

    An 18-year-old man whose sister has classic Kartagener's syndrome was found to have sinusitis, bronchiectasis, and corrected transposition with normal visceral situs. Congenital complete heart block was secondary to absence of conducting-system pathways between a small posterior atrioventricular node and the transposed His bundle and bundle branches. No anterior atrioventricular node was present. Prosthetic valvular replacement of the left-sided (morphologic right) atrioventricular valve was complicated by coronary arterial occlusion by suture, with subsequent myocardial infarction. The case appears to represent an unusual variant of Kartagener's syndrome with the abnormality of laterality being expressed as corrected transposition.

5/111. Intraoperative myocardial ischemia recognized by transesophageal echocardiography monitoring in the pediatric population: a report of 3 cases.

    We used continuous intraoperative transesophageal echocardiography (TEE) monitoring to detect intraoperative myocardial ischemia in children after they had been weaned from cardiopulmonary bypass for cardiac surgery. Three pediatric patients are described here to illustrate the usefulness of such TEE monitoring in surgical procedures involving coronary arteries. The indications for intraoperative TEE monitoring and a simplified scheme for immediate qualitative interpretation are discussed.

6/111. Unusual complication after total correction of transposition of the great arteries. A case report.

    A patient is described in whom the Mustard operation was carried out with the baffle sutured cephalad to the coronary sinus. This caused severe arterial desaturation which disappeared after the baffle was transposed caudad to the coronary sinus.

7/111. Transposition of great arteries and single coronary artery: a new surgical technique for the arterial switch operation.

    A single coronary artery can complicate the surgical technique of arterial switch operations, impairing early and late outcomes. We propose a new surgical approach, successfully applied in a 2.1 kg neonate, aimed at reducing the risk of early and late compression and/or distortion of the newly constructed coronary artery system.

8/111. Pulmonary root translocation for biventricular repair of double-outlet left ventricle.

    Double-outlet left ventricle is conventionally repaired with an extracardiac conduit when pulmonary stenosis is present. We report the use of pulmonary root translocation to the right ventricle to construct the posterior wall with autologous tissue and a porcine pericardial monocusp ventricular outflow patch anteriorly for 2 patients with double-outlet left ventricle. This technique allows minimization of pulmonary insufficiency, avoids coronary artery ligation with infundibulotomy, and has a major theoretical advantage for growth potential.

9/111. infection of a retained permanent epicardial pacemaker lead.

    infection of a retained permanent epicardial pacemaker lead rarely causes mediastinal infection. A 21-month-old boy who had undergone an arterial switch operation at day 6 of life presented with mediastinal infection 3 months after removal of the generator. Removal of the infected pacemaker leads with the inflammatory granuloma was performed under extracorporeal circulation. The mediastinal infection developed from the retained epicardial pacemaker lead infection.

10/111. Coronary revascularization after arterial switch operation.

    We report two cases presenting bilateral coronary artery obstruction after arterial switch operation. The first patient underwent bilateral internal thoracic artery grafting to the left and right coronary arteries. The other patient, presenting a single coronary ostium, underwent surgical coronary ostial angioplasty in concomitance to proximal arterioplasty of both coronary arteries employing a single "pantaloon" shape autologous pericardial patch. Both patients survived and, at 1 year and 9 months after the coronary revascularization procedures, the coronary angiography demonstrated a good patency of the internal thoracic grafts and excellent ostial plasty results, respectively. A complete literature review of patients undergoing different coronary revascularization procedures after arterial switch operation is reported.
